Whittier College, Los Angeles:
Whittier College, located in Whittier (12 miles southeast of Los Angeles), California, is a private liberal-arts college offering undergraduate and graduate degree programs. Through an education that is rooted in the liberal arts tradition, students choose from among 30 majors and 30 minors, or create their own course of study through the Whittier Scholars Program. Our long academic tradition—grounded in the Quaker quest for knowledge and personal growth—aims to foster in students an appreciation for the complexities of the modern world and workplace while never losing sight of the importance of social responsibility.

Pomona College, located in Claremont (35 miles east of downtown Los Angeles), California, is a private residential liberal arts college offering a choice of 45 bachelor degree programs, including all of the traditional disciplines of the humanities, fine arts, social sciences and natural sciences, as well as a variety of interdisciplinary fields. Majors at Pomona are not designed primarily to prepare students for specific careers, but rather to sharpen their ability to think critically and in depth using the analytical methods of the discipline. As part of the overall Pomona education, however, all majors have been shown to provide an outstanding foundation for success in whatever follows graduation—whether it be further study or the immediate start of a career.

The American College of Traditional Chinese Medicine (ACTCM) is located in San Francisco, California.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) is an ancient and profound healing art that originated more than 3,000 years ago. It comprises a number of therapeutic practices—among them Chinese herbology, acupuncture, nutrition, Tai Ji Quan and Qigong—that have long-proven efficacy in treating a wide range of disease conditions.

Our two degree programs—the Master of Science in Traditional Chinese Medicine (MSTCM) and the Doctorate of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ine (DAOM)—provide a truly exceptional professional education. Additionally, ACTCM’s certificate programs in Tui Na and Shiatsu and its introductory classes for the public offer further opportunities for study to current ACTCM students, healthcare professionals and the general public. ACTCM also offers an optional 4-week study abroad program in Shanghai, China to students of the MSTCM program.

Our MSTCM degree program is accredited by the Accreditation Commission for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ine (ACAOM). ACAOM has also approved ACTCM’s clinical DAOM degree.
